How To Fix Netflix Not Opening On Mac

Fix Netflix Not Opening on Mac

## Direct Answer
If Netflix won’t open on your Mac, try restarting your computer, checking for software updates, and clearing browser cache. If you’re using the Netflix app, ensure it’s up-to-date and try reinstalling it.

## Step-by-Step Guide
To fix Netflix not opening on your Mac, follow these steps:
1. **Restart your Mac**: Sometimes, a simple reboot can resolve the issue.
2. **Check for software updates**: Ensure your Mac and Netflix app are up-to-date, as outdated software can cause compatibility issues.
3. **Clear browser cache**: Clearing your browser’s cache and cookies can help resolve issues with Netflix.
4. **Disable extensions**: Try disabling any recently installed browser extensions, as they might be interfering with Netflix.
5. **Reinstall the Netflix app**: If you’re using the Netflix app, try uninstalling and reinstalling it.
6. **Check your internet connection**: Ensure your internet connection is stable and working properly.
7. **Try a different browser**: If Netflix won’t open in one browser, try using a different browser to see if the issue persists.

### Q: How do I clear my browser cache on a Mac?
A: The steps to clear browser cache vary depending on the browser you’re using. For Safari, go to Safari > Preferences > Advanced > Show Develop menu in menu bar, then click Develop > Empty Caches.
